Hydrostatic Transmission Pump Market size is estimated to register more than 3.5% CAGR between 2024 and 2032, driven by their superior efficiency and performance compared to traditional mechanical transmission systems. The ability of hydrostatic transmission pumps to deliver variable speed control, smooth operation, and power-on-demand is contributing significantly to their adoption across various applications. For example, in October 2023, AMSOIL launched a new commercial-grade tractor hydraulic/transmission oil for agricultural and commercial equipment to provide exceptional value to customers looking for an upgrade from conventional and synthetic-blend oils.
Continuous technological advancements and innovations will also help in propelling the industry growth. Manufacturers are increasingly investing in R&D to enhance product features, reliability, and durability while reducing maintenance requirements. Integration of smart technologies, such as IoT-enabled sensors and predictive analytics will further augment the functionality and performance of hydrostatic transmission pumps.

By pump, the hydrostatic transmission pump market from the fixed displacement pump segment is anticipated to witness substantial growth through 2032, due to their reliability, simplicity, and cost-effectiveness. These pumps provide a constant flow rate regardless of pressure changes, making them ideal for various industrial applications, such as hydraulic systems in construction, manufacturing, and agriculture. The straightforward design and consistent performance of the pumps also reduces maintenance requirements and operational complexities, attracting customers seeking durable and efficient solutions.
Based on application, the industry size from the mining segment will generate notable revenue during 2024-2032, backed by demanding operational requirements and the strong need for reliable, high-performance equipment. Hydrostatic transmission pumps offer variable speed control, precise torque delivery, and enhanced fuel efficiency. These pumps also enable efficient power transfer in various mining equipment, such as excavators, loaders, and haul trucks for enhancing productivity and reducing operational costs.
Europe hydrostatic transmission pump industry is slated to witness a significant growth rate through 2032, attributed to stringent emissions regulations and the rising focus on sustainability initiatives. With increasing environmental concerns, industries across Europe are transitioning towards more eco-friendly and energy-efficient solutions, including hydrostatic transmission pumps. Additionally, the growing demand for construction and agricultural machinery equipped with advanced hydraulic systems will further fuel the regional market growth.
